Output 29a66fced028bacf7207de5d910dabb7f6494e87aaf1af76c23f1eb9b242d7e7:1

value
3531332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f72805b49b2d26b8c4cb94f19147553ff8046979 OP_EQUAL
address
3QDrmitqvnnMW5wgLF2CZoJBdArYswGMen
transaction
29a66fced028bacf7207de5d910dabb7f6494e87aaf1af76c23f1eb9b242d7e7
spent
true